[1st place in Romance in TheMysticalAwards, Honorable Mention in Romance in the Rebel Wars Awards] "The woman in front of her had seemed like a magical creature: Wild, unbound and stupefying pretty." Robin Mills, 22 years old, living in Seattle, stands at a crossroads in her life. Having a dysfunctional mother-daughter-relationship, a so far unused college degree and her cousin's couch to sleep on, might not mark the best position in her life. Accompanying said cousin to an art exhibition does not seem very promising either. Little does she know that she will run into somebody who will rock her world very, very soon. Alice Jones has finally made it! Her path is not about running away from the prison which has been her home in the UK. Not any longer! For the first time since leaving her country and moving to Seattle she is truly chasing her dreams. Due to a turn of events the best day of her life might become even more beautified - literally. Apparantly, happy accidents do exist! A female, modern Robin Hood meets a modern Alice in Wonderland. A contribution for #PrideMonth, #FreeTheLGBT and #WattPride. Based on characters of the TV show "Once Upon A Time". #TalentAwards2018 #projectdiscoveryourtalent

A tale in which a thief with a double life grudgingly becomes a hero. ➳ Liana Mason has a life anyone would envy. Nobody suspects that the once orphaned girl grew up to be the city's notorious vigilante. She has been fine walking on the edge of morality for much of her life, but when an assassin arrives in her city she's forced to play a role she never imagined she'd choose: hero. A Robin Hood retelling. Trigger Warning: This contains themes that may be triggering for some readers (violence, sexual assault, etc). Cover designed by Ray Gardener
